The Essentials of Alcohol Production



Although the process of alcohol production can differ extensively amongst different types, it normally entails four vital phases: fermentation, distillation, aging, and bottling. Each phase plays a crucial function in forming the end product's character and flavor.During fermentation, yeast transforms sugars into alcohol, laying the foundation for the alcohol's toughness and significance. Following this, purification separates alcohol from various other parts, enhancing purity and focus. This stage can use various techniques, such as pot stills or column stills, influencing the resulting spirit's appearance and complexity.Aging occurs in wood barrels, allowing interaction in between the wood and the alcohol, presenting distinctive flavors and fragrances. The duration and kind of wood considerably influence the last account. Finally, bottling seals the item for distribution, typically with very little filtering to preserve taste integrity. Recognizing these phases provides understanding into the complexities of alcohol production and its influence on taste profiles.


Fermentation: The Structure of Taste



How does fermentation shape the distinct flavors of liquor? Fermentation is an essential process that transforms sugars into alcohol, acting as the structure for an alcohol's special taste profile. During fermentation, yeast consumes sugars present in the raw materials, such as grains, fruits, or sugarcane, producing not just ethanol yet additionally a selection of fragrant compounds. These compounds include esters, phenols, and acids, which add to the intricacy and depth of the final product.Different yeast strains can present differing flavor features, resulting in diverse accounts also from the exact same base material. Furthermore, fermentation problems-- such as temperature level and time-- can additionally influence the taste development. The interaction of these variables causes a spectrum of tastes, from fruity and flower to spicy and earthy. Eventually, fermentation prepares for the unique tastes that specify various alcohols, making it an essential step in the manufacturing process.

Purification: Focusing the Significance



Purification acts as a critical process in liquor manufacturing, concentrating the essence of the fermented base. This approach entails heating the fermented fluid to separate alcohol from water and various other parts, counting on differences in steaming factors. As the mix is heated up, alcohol vapor climbs, leaving much heavier compounds. The vapor is after that cooled down and condensed back into fluid kind, generating a much more potent spirit.The process not only boosts alcohol web content but additionally captures a range of unstable substances that add to the liquor's flavor profile. Depending on the purification method-- be it pot still or column still-- producers can affect the final personality of the spirit. Pot stills typically keep even more of the base's original tastes, while column stills generate a cleaner, higher-proof product. Inevitably, distillation is crucial for specifying the unique features of numerous liquors, establishing the phase for additional development in subsequent processes.

After distillation, aging plays a considerable duty in forming the final flavor account of alcohol. Throughout this process, the spirit is typically kept in wood barrels, which give special attributes via their interaction with the liquor. The kind of wood, such as oak, along with its previous use, influences the intricacy of flavors that establish over time.As the alcohol ages, it undertakes chemical changes; substances from the wood, including vanillin and tannins, are taken in, including notes of vanilla, spice, and sugar. All at once, dissipation takes place, focusing the tastes and smoothing any extreme edges.The period of aging is equally vital; longer aging periods can generate richer, much more nuanced profiles. An over-aged spirit may come to be excessively woody or shed its initial character. Ultimately, the delicate equilibrium of timber and time specifies the alcohol's distinctiveness, developing a sensory experience that reflects both craftsmanship and nature.


Components: Fruits, botanicals, and grains



While the aging procedure substantially influences flavor, the initial ingredients made use of in alcohol production lay the foundation for its character. Grains, fruits, and botanicals each impart distinctive high qualities to the last item. Grains such as barley, corn, rye, and wheat are essential in spirits like scotch and vodka, giving a variety of sweetness, spiciness, and texture. The option of grain can develop a robust body or a smooth coating, shaping the general experience.Fruits, usually utilized in liqueurs and gins, add a range of tastes from citrusy and sharp to abundant and sweet. This infusion can improve intricacy, stabilizing the inherent attributes of the base spirit. Botanicals, consisting of seasonings, blossoms, and herbs, further boost taste accounts, specifically in gin. These ingredients offer distinctive preferences and aromatic subtleties, cultivating an unique identity for each alcohol and welcoming expedition right into the diverse world of tastes.

Tasting Terminology Explained



Tasting terminology serves as a vital framework for interacting the elaborate feelings experienced during liquor sampling - Twin Liquor. It includes particular vocabulary that describes flavors, fragrances, and mouthfeel. Terms such as "nose" describe the scents sensed while scenting the alcohol, while "taste buds" indicates the tastes perceived on the tongue. Common sampling notes consist of descriptors like fruity, spicy, or earthy, helping cups verbalize their experiences. The term "finish" highlights the lingering experiences after ingesting, revealing added intricacies. Understanding these terms enables specialists and enthusiasts alike to share insights efficiently, boosting gratitude of the alcohol's distinct flavor profile. Inevitably, sampling terminology bridges individual experiences and collective understanding, fostering a deeper link to the art of alcohol sampling
